Overview:
WD Chart is a graphical traffic monitor that shows the performance of any inbound or outbound trunkgroup in 15 minute intervals over the past 36 hours. The program reads the real-time CDR data collected by Switch Watchdog and then graphs five key measures of route performance in color-coded stacked charts. This unique real-time visual presentation makes it simple to spot trouble or downward trends in quality, as well as day-to-day fluctuations that could indicate changing market conditions.
Features:
The program displays five charts in a stacked configuration to allow visual association of different statistics occuring in the same time period. The statistics tracked are as follows:

  - ASR (in red)
  - Average Call Duration (in blue)
  - Average Answer Delay (in violet)
  - Total Minutes (in yellow)
  - Total Calls (in green)
Hardware Requirements:
WD Chart must run on the same PC that is running Switch Watchdog, so its hardware requirements are those of Switch Watchdog, namely:

  - Pentium II or better 
  - 128MB Ram
  - 4GB Hard disk
  - Network card
